Statue Care Guide
- Display with Care: Preserve your statue in a glass cabinet to protect it from dust, moisture, and accidental damage.
- Dusting: Use a soft, clean cotton cloth to gently wipe away dust. Avoid using rough or abrasive materials.
- Minimize Handling: Avoid touching gold-plated statues frequently, as natural oils from your skin can accelerate tarnishing.
- Do Not Scrub: Never use steel wool, metal-bristled brushes, or scrubbing pads. These can scratch and damage delicate surfaces.

Green Tara
Green Tara, known as the "Mother of Liberation," is a prominent figure in Tibetan Buddhism, embodying compassionate action and swift assistance. She is depicted seated in a relaxed posture with her right leg extended, symbolizing her readiness to leap into action to aid those in distress, while her left leg remains folded, representing inner contemplation and calm. Her right hand gestures in varada mudra, the gesture of giving and generosity, while her left hand, held in abhaya mudra with fingers gently holding a blue lotus (utpala), signifies protection and the bestowal of blessings. The green hue of her body signifies rejuvenation, vitality, and the nurturing aspect of nature, embodying her role as a savior who alleviates fears and obstacles, particularly those related to physical, emotional, and spiritual challenges. Revered for her unwavering compassion, Green Tara is a symbol of hope, swiftness, and the boundless love that liberates beings from suffering.
